The control of cellular activity, for example the augmentation of the regenerative process in tendon tissue is not triggered by applying a random electric current to the affected area. In a similar way to a drug dosage targeting a specific cell function, a specific amperage, polarity and pulse rate should be used that synchronizes with specific parameters of the cell type to promote/augment the restoration of the targeted process. Synapse patented programmes incorporate research findings into a series of pre-set programmes specific to certain cell types, for example tendon and dermal cells.
Synapse’s micro-current technology is based upon a proprietary sequence of electrical parameters that are specific to a given physiological process. Research has indicated that cells interpret and respond more readily to a sequence, which mimics the body’s own cellular electrical signaling processes, than to just one single electrical current. An example of this relates to gap junction function; an enhanced molecular flow rate between cells is created when one set of treatment parameters are applied facilitating an acceleration of cellular reproduction. This same response is not seen when an alternative treatment programme is applied to the same cell type

Synapse medical products are currently undergoing testing for full
Medical Devices Directive approval to be registered medical product
as Class IIA devices under the quality management system ISO 13485.
In addition, (for human use) Synapse has applied for the Tendonworks
product to be included as a N.I.C.E (National Institute of health and
Clinical Excellence) approved product. All Synapse products carry the
CE marking.
